Output 1604434add88273ba48fe0efc987de45e1120fcf98ecc14442e41ededba791fa:0

value
27489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b679d2be71d481a3bf5059b7b00ed317229880 OP_EQUAL
address
383d9Rf1GgLcXjPBXSwx9CAVs59fuEiU1h
transaction
1604434add88273ba48fe0efc987de45e1120fcf98ecc14442e41ededba791fa
spent
true